Since “GTA 5” is approaching its sixth year anniversary, it’s no surprise that fans of the franchise are asking questions about the next entry. So far, however, Rockstar has yet to break their silence about “GTA 6” and the plans they have for the title going forward.
As such, most of the news surrounding the next title is coming from rumors. One particular narrative that’s been touched upon by the franchise’s fan base is the potential protagonist of “GTA 6.” There are three rumors that have emerged from this discussion, GTABoom reported.
First, “GTA 6” will apparently have multiple protagonists. If Rockstar goes this route, it wouldn’t be surprising since the fifth entry offered three options to choose from. This time, however, it’s touted that there will only be two. What’s more, they’re going to be male and female.
Second, the pair will allegedly be voice by Ryan Gosling and Eve Mendes. Of course, people should take this information with heavy skepticism given that Rockstar isn’t the type of studio to bring in popular Hollywood icons. Part of the reason for this is that it might break a player’s immersion when they’re playing “GTA 6.”
Indeed, “Death Stranding” is already experiencing this discontent after some players voiced their concern about how it feels “weird” playing as Norman Reedus. As for the third rumor, the male and female protagonists of “GTA 6” will apparently be polar opposites of each other – one being a cop and the other a career criminal.
Players will have the option to control both characters throughout the story as the plot unfolds toward its conclusion. Having said all of these, it’s best to take this information with a grain of salt given that Rockstar hasn’t announced anything about “GTA 6.” Even the release date for the title remains unknown until now, with speculations ranging between 2020 and 2022.
